I've been following the pricing of the 2020 World Cruise segments and they have held steady.  Given Seabourn's pricing on past cruises, I had expected to see some reduction or at least the offering of various inducements i.e. cabin upgrades, OBC, internet packages, etc.  Perhaps some of the TA's have heard rumblings and passed them on to others.  If anyone has any information, it would be appreciated.

We got a brochure the other day advertising the world cruise. The Singapore to Hong Kong section was one of the specials. It was for 12 nights, didn’t stop at Halong Bay or Da Nang which is included on our 14 day cruise on the Ovation. 

 

The world cruise segment was quite expensive, although it did have  considerable air credit.
